Notes & Features: Based on the previous Nikon D2X model. Can be switched to a high-speed cropped mode, which allows 8 frames per second. This mode reduces resolution to 6.8 megapixels, cropped from the center of the sensor. This increases the effective focal length multiplier to 2.0x, and reduces the number of useable AF points to nine. The cropped area is indicated by a user-selectable shaded crop in the viewfinder. Both matrix and center-weighted metering revised to work normally within cropped area in high-speed cropped mode. New LCD display as previously seen in the Nikon D200. New EN-EL4a battery type has increased power. Black and white mode added (color can be restored in NEF Raw mode). Cropping in camera is possible. Camera settings can be saved and loaded (so they can be shared among a set of users). Burst mode now runs 1-60 rather than 1-35. 'Recent Settings' lets you quickly review your most recent changes (like the D200) -- and you can lock them. Image authentication enabled (for forensic shooting), guaranteeing the image has not been altered. A hardware/software approach using a USB key to guarantee software hasn't been hacked, too. Focus tracking with lock and short or long duration options. Multiple custom curves can be loaded.
